亡くなる
"亡くなる" means "to pass away" or "to die."
In this sentence, "亡くなりました" is used as a respectful way to indicate someone's passing, commonly referring to others in a polite context.
彼のおじいさんは昨年亡くなりました。
His grandfather passed away last year.
Here, "亡くなってしまった" expresses the sorrowful occurrence of someone's passing, in this case referring to a pet, showing a personal and emotional context.
犬が老衰で亡くなってしまったので、とても悲しいです。
I am very sad because our dog passed away due to old age.
